Soc'ul'
Etymology
From Sekhulla kurhən, from Wascotl *kor-fen-.
Pronunciation
Noun
curjen class 5 (plural/indefinite ez'e curjen)
- dark blue object
- Cuuc' xen'e curjen éá.
- I saw a huge dark blue thing in the distance.
Adjective
curjen
- dark blue
- Coxeu en n'ehx curjen.
- Find me a dark blue flower.
